哈希趣投游戏系统开发,技术与设计探索哈希趣投游戏系统开发

好,用户让我写一篇关于“哈希趣投游戏系统开发”的文章,先写标题,再写内容,内容不少于3109个字,看起来用户可能是在准备一篇技术文章,介绍一个有趣的哈希链表游戏系统的开发过程,用户可能希望文章既有技术细节,又有游戏设计的亮点,吸引读者的兴趣。 我需要明确用户的需求,用户可能是一位游戏开发人员,或者是一位技术爱好者,希望分享关于哈希表在游戏开发中的应用,用户的需求不仅仅是写一篇技术文章,而是希望文章能够吸引读者,展示哈希表在游戏中的独特魅力。 我需要考虑文章的结构,技术文章通常包括引言、技术背景、系统设计、开发过程、测试与优化、结论等部分,标题要吸引人,同时点明主题,哈希趣投游戏系统开发:技术与设计探索”。 在引言部分,我需要提到哈希链表的特性如何转化为游戏体验,激发读者的兴趣,技术背景部分要解释哈希表在计算机科学中的重要性,以及游戏开发中的应用,比如数据快速查找、缓存机制等。 系统设计部分需要详细描述游戏的核心模块,比如角色创建、游戏规则、互动机制、数据结构设计等,开发过程可以分阶段描述,从需求分析到原型设计,再到功能实现,最后进行测试和优化。 测试与优化部分要说明游戏在不同场景下的表现,比如流畅度、稳定性,以及如何通过优化提升用户体验,结论部分总结开发成果,展望未来可能的改进方向。 在写作过程中,要注意使用技术术语,但也要保持语言通俗易懂,让读者能够理解,加入一些游戏设计的亮点,比如画面效果、音乐音效,让文章更生动有趣。 检查文章是否符合字数要求,确保内容详实,结构清晰,逻辑连贯,这样,用户的需求就能得到满足,文章也会吸引更多的读者。 我需要开始撰写文章,确保每个部分都涵盖必要的内容,同时保持文章的流畅性和吸引力,从技术背景到系统设计,再到开发过程和测试优化,每个部分都要详细展开,展示哈希表在游戏开发中的应用和优势。 确保文章的标题和结构符合用户的要求,内容原创,避免任何错误或重复,完成后,再通读一遍,确保逻辑清晰,语言流畅,吸引读者的兴趣。

在当今快速发展的科技时代,游戏开发不仅仅是娱乐,更是一种创新的表达方式,哈希链表作为一种高效的数据结构,在游戏开发中展现出独特的魅力,本文将介绍一种基于哈希表的游戏系统——“哈希趣投”,并探讨其开发过程中的技术与设计思路。

技术背景

哈希表(Hash Table)是一种高效的数据结构,用于实现字典、集合等抽象数据类型,它的核心优势在于通过哈希函数快速定位数据,从而实现O(1)时间复杂度的平均查找效率,在游戏开发中,哈希表可以用于快速查找玩家信息、管理游戏资源等场景。

“哈希趣投”是一款以哈希表为主题的互动游戏,玩家通过操作虚拟角色在虚拟世界中进行“投资”和“交易”,游戏的核心在于通过哈希表实现高效的玩家数据管理,同时结合趣味化的互动设计,提升玩家的游戏体验。

系统设计

角色管理模块

在“哈希趣投”中,每个玩家都有自己的虚拟角色,为了高效管理这些角色,我们采用了哈希表来存储玩家信息,具体设计如下:

  • :玩家的唯一ID(如用户名或注册码)。
  • :玩家角色的属性信息,包括位置坐标、属性值(如血量、等级等)、技能信息等。

通过哈希表,玩家角色的快速查找和更新操作得以实现,确保游戏运行的高效性。

游戏规则与互动机制

游戏中的互动机制是系统的核心,通过哈希表,我们可以快速定位到目标玩家进行互动。

  • 投资与交易:玩家可以通过游戏界面进行虚拟货币的“投资”和“交易”,系统通过哈希表快速查找目标玩家的虚拟资产,并完成交易操作。
  • 技能使用:玩家可以通过技能条来释放特定技能,系统通过哈希表快速定位到目标技能,并执行技能操作。

画面与音效同步机制

为了提升游戏体验,我们在系统设计中考虑了画面与音效的同步显示,通过哈希表快速定位到当前场景中的关键元素(如敌人、道具等),并及时更新画面和音效。

开发过程

需求分析

在开发“哈希趣投”之前,我们进行了详细的用户需求分析,主要需求包括:

  • 玩家角色的快速创建与管理。
  • 互动操作的高效执行。
  • 游戏画面与音效的同步更新。

原型设计

基于需求分析,我们设计了游戏的原型系统,重点包括:

  • 哈希表的键值设计。
  • 互动操作的流程设计。
  • 画面与音效的同步机制。

功能实现

在原型设计的基础上,我们开始实现游戏功能,主要步骤如下:

  1. 玩家角色创建:通过哈希表快速创建玩家角色,并设置初始属性。
  2. 互动操作:实现投资、交易、技能释放等功能,并通过哈希表快速定位目标。
  3. 画面与音效更新:在每次操作后,及时更新画面和音效,提升游戏体验。

测试与优化

在功能实现后,我们进行了大量的测试和优化,重点包括:

  • 性能测试:确保游戏在高并发情况下依然流畅。
  • 用户体验测试:收集玩家反馈,优化操作流程和界面设计。

测试与优化

在测试阶段,我们主要关注以下几个方面:

  1. 性能测试:通过模拟大量玩家同时进行操作,测试系统的响应速度和稳定性。
  2. 用户体验测试:通过玩家测试,收集反馈,优化操作流程和界面设计。
  3. 画面与音效同步测试:确保画面更新与音效同步,提升游戏体验。

通过多次测试和优化,我们确保了系统的高效性和玩家的沉浸感。

“哈希趣投”是一款以哈希表为主题的互动游戏,通过高效的哈希表管理玩家数据,结合趣味化的互动设计,为玩家提供了丰富的游戏体验,本文详细介绍了游戏的系统设计与开发过程,展示了哈希表在游戏开发中的独特优势。

我们计划进一步优化游戏的画面与音效系统,同时探索更多基于哈希表的游戏应用场景,为玩家带来更多精彩的游戏体验。

发表评论